Church holidays

Week 12 after Pentecost. No fasting. Beginning of the indiction – the church new year.

September 14 is the day of remembrance of St. Simeon the Stylite and his mother Martha of Cappadocia.

Name days: Martha, Natalia, Semyon, Tatyana.

Events of September 14

In 1812 Napoleon Bonaparte entered Moscow.

In 1867, the first volume of Karl Marx's Capital was published.

In 1954, at the Totsk test site (Orenburg region), exercises were conducted under conditions of a real nuclear explosion.

In 1960, the Organization of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) was founded.

In 1973, Kerch and Novorossiysk were awarded the title of Hero City.

Folk omens

If it is warm on Semin's Day, then the winter will be mild.

A cloudy morning promises a rainy autumn.

The starlings and wild ducks have not flown away yet – expect a dry and long autumn season.
